CIS ranked among the top searched stocks for 8 days in the past month.


As of 12:30 PM on the 15th, CIS is trading at 14,500 KRW, up 4.32% from the previous day. This represents a 103.94% increase compared to December 17. CIS is known as a specialized company in secondary battery production equipment.

Today, foreigners have sold a net 47,000 shares of CIS, and institutions have sold a net 3,000 shares, according to provisional data. Over the past 5 days, individual investors have sold a net 771,443 shares, while foreigners and institutions have sold a net 124,545 shares and bought a net 872,548 shares, respectively.
